Hello David Ahern,

The patch acda655fefae: "selftests: Add nettest" from Aug 1, 2019,
leads to the following static checker warning:

	./tools/testing/selftests/net/nettest.c:1690 main()
	warn: unsigned 'tmp' is never less than zero.

./tools/testing/selftests/net/nettest.c
  1680                  case '1':
  1681                          args.has_expected_raddr = 1;
  1682                          if (convert_addr(&args, optarg,
  1683                                           ADDR_TYPE_EXPECTED_REMOTE))
  1684                                  return 1;
  1685  
  1686                          break;
  1687                  case '2':
  1688                          if (str_to_uint(optarg, 0, 0x7ffffff, &tmp) != 0) {
  1689                                  tmp = get_ifidx(optarg);
  1690                                  if (tmp < 0) {

"tmp" is unsigned so it can't be negative.  Also all the callers assume
that get_ifidx() returns negatives on error but it looks like it really
returns zero on error so it's a bit unclear to me.

  1691                                          fprintf(stderr,
  1692                                                  "Invalid device index\n");
  1693                                          return 1;
  1694                                  }
  1695                          }
  1696                          args.expected_ifindex = (int)tmp;
  1697                          break;
  1698                  case 'q':
  1699                          quiet = 1;
